Innovative EdTech Tools Transforming Eco-learning

A⁢ wave of​ EdTech innovations is making eco-learning more immersive ‍and practical. Let’s‍ look at some standout tools and examples:

1. Virtual Reality​ (VR) Nature⁣ Expeditions

⁢ ⁤ Platforms‌ like ‌ Google​ Expeditions or EcoVR take students on virtual tours to rainforests,​ coral reefs,⁢ and polar ice​ caps. Learners can explore⁢ remote‌ habitats and witness climate phenomena up close, fostering ⁢empathy and ‌a sense of responsibility.

2. ⁢Mobile Applications for Citizen Science

⁣ Apps such as iNaturalist, Project Noah, and Earth Challenge 2020 empower students to observe,​ record, and share data about local biodiversity.This real-world engagement⁢ deepens ecological awareness and contributes valuable data ⁢to ‌scientific ‌databases.

3. Gamified Sustainability Platforms

Games like Eco and SimCityEDU challenge players ​to build and ⁣manage sustainable ⁣societies, balancing economic growth with environmental ‌stewardship. Through scenario-based​ play, students internalize complex concepts such as resource management and policy-making.

4.​ Interactive Online Courses & MOOCs

⁣ ‌Massive Open Online Courses (MOOCs) from platforms like‌ Coursera,​ EdX, and Khan Academy offer thorough environmental curricula covering ⁢climate change, renewable energy, and conservation science,⁢ often ⁣supplemented with multimedia and‍ cloud-based collaboration tools.

5. Smart Classroom Sensors & IoT

Internet of Things (IoT)‍ devices and classroom ‌sensors help monitor energy consumption, air quality, and water⁣ usage ⁣in real-time, creating opportunities⁢ for hands-on data analysis and sustainable ⁤school initiatives.

Real-World Case Studies: Eco-Learning in ⁢Action

Many schools, institutions, and communities are leveraging EdTech to enact meaningful environmental education programs. here are a few inspiring examples:

  • WWF’s Wild Classroom: The World Wildlife Fund⁤ developed an online portal‍ featuring⁤ interactive games and lesson plans addressing topics ⁣such as deforestation and wildlife preservation. Teachers can access ready-to-use resources that blend technology with action-based ⁣learning.
  • NatureBridge Virtual Environmental Science: With in-person field trips curtailed, NatureBridge’s digital platform offers remote, interactive science labs ⁤and ecological fieldwork simulations, helping students continue eco-learning irrespective of location.
  • Eco-Schools Global: Utilizing online​ tracking systems, ⁢Eco-Schools empowers students to ⁤monitor their⁤ school’s⁢ environmental footprint and collaborate on sustainability solutions, linking real-world impact to digital learning.

Practical Tips for Effective Tech-Driven Environmental‍ Education

‍ ‍Interested in integrating EdTech into your environmental lesson plans? Here are some‍ best ⁣practices to get you started:

  1. Start Small:

    • Begin with one⁣ tool or application that⁢ aligns with ⁤your curriculum.

  2. Leverage Multimedia:

    • mix​ videos,⁢ infographics, simulations, and interactive quizzes to accommodate⁤ diverse learning styles.

  3. Connect Learning to real-World Action:

    • encourage students to participate in local eco-projects or citizen science programs, bridging digital ⁣knowledge with hands-on impact.

  4. Prioritize Accessibility:

    • Choose​ platforms that are mobile-friendly ‌and compatible with ‌various devices,‌ ensuring ⁣inclusivity for all learners.

  5. assess and Reflect:

    • Use analytics tools‍ to ⁢track progress,gather feedback,and pivot ⁤your approach as⁤ needed for‌ continuous⁣ improvement.
